Etymology
From the word ‘timingila’ is as follows: in Sanskrit तिमि "timi" is the word for ‘whale’ and गिल "gila" means ‘to swallow'. Thus timingila literally means ‘to swallow a whale’ – not just to swallow, but to swallow in one huge bite! In Tamil people: refers to translated as whales in general.
